| Year | Event | Ezra Koenig Age |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1984 | Date of birth | 0 | Born in New York City on April 8, 1984 |
| 2002 | High school graduation | 18 | Attended Collegiate School in Manhattan |
| 2008 | Vampire Weekend debut album | 24 | Released June 2008 to critical acclaim |
| 2013 | Modern Vampires of the City release | 29 | Album won Grammy for Best Alternative Music Album |
| 2024 | Current activity and upcoming projects | 40 | Continues to perform and create new music |
Early Life and Education Context
Ezra Koenig age during his formative years helps explain his rapid rise in the music industry. Growing up in New York City, he attended local public schools before enrolling at Columbia University. His academic focus on anthropology influenced his lyrical themes and narrative style.
At Columbia, he met future bandmates and began developing the indie sound that would define Vampire Weekend. Understanding his educational path provides insight into the intellectual backdrop of his music.

How old is Ezra Koenig in 2024?
Born on April 8, 1984, Ezra Koenig is 40 years old in 2024.
At what age did Vampire Weekend release their first album? He was 24 years old when Vampire Weekend’s debut self-titled album was released in 2008. What was Ezra Koenig’s age during the Grammy win for Modern Vampires of the City?
He was 29 when the album won Best Alternative Music Album at the 2014 Grammy Awards.
